Position: Senior Administrative Analyst/Trainee 1/2 - Albany (NY HELPS)
Location: City of Albany

Overview

Assist language testers with training and testing of IVR. Troubleshoot issues and update testing reports. Analyze and troubleshoot interface testing issues from a technology and business process view. Interfaces are critical to UI Program claims, payments, fraud prevention, and federal and state reporting.

Responsibilities
  • Assist language testers with training and testing of IVR. Troubleshoot issues and update testing reports.
  • Analyze and troubleshoot interface testing issues from a technology and business process view. Interfaces are critical to UI Program claims, payments, fraud prevention, and federal and state reporting.
  • Support detailed implementation plans for large modernization projects including: overall go-live schedule, application testing, data migration, infrastructure, training, interfaces, data warehouse, security, technical go-live steps, dry runs, upgrade period, help desk, go-no go decision criteria, and knowledge transfer.
  • Analyze, and confirm accuracy of completion of implementation categories and steps.
  • Provide weekly detailed reports and executive summaries.
  • Facilitate interface and other technical troubleshooting meetings.
  • User Acceptance Testing (UAT) Test Case Assignments using Mastercraft.
  • Analyze accuracy of UAT test cases, testing progress, blocks, and results; provide detailed reports to management using Mastercraft and MS Excel.
  • Work with program staff and stakeholders to develop test scenarios and test cases.
  • Obtain and analyze correctness of test data from over 100 interface partners.
  • Troubleshoot interface testing issues from a technology and business process view. Interfaces are critical to UI Program claims, payments, fraud prevention, and federal and state reporting.
  • Deliverable analysis and tracking for technology vendors.

Minimum Qualifications

This title is part of the New York Hiring for Emergency Limited Placement Statewide program (NY HELPS). For the duration of the NY HELPS Program, this title may be filled via a non-competitive appointment, if they meet the below NY HELPS minimum qualifications.

NY HELPS Non-Competitive

Minimum Qualifications
  • Administrative Analyst Trainee 1: Four years of experience conducting management and organizational studies to review and revise procedures for new or changing programs, review organizational performance, and develop internal controls; collecting data and conducting cost benefit or systems analysis to assist with organizational change; evaluating and developing recommendations to improve program operations and effectiveness; and designing and updating procedure manuals, forms, and policy.

    An associate degree may substitute for two years of experience; a bachelor’s degree may substitute for four years of experience; a master’s degree may substitute for five years of experience; and a doctorate may substitute for six years of experience.
  • Administrative Analyst Trainee 2: Five years of experience conducting management and organizational studies to review and revise procedures for new or changing programs, review organizational performance, and develop internal controls; collecting data and conducting cost benefit or systems analysis to assist with organizational change; evaluating and developing recommendations to improve program operations and effectiveness; and designing and updating procedure manuals, forms, and policy.

    An associate degree may substitute for two years of experience; a bachelor’s degree may substitute for four years of experience; a master’s degree may substitute for five years of experience; and a doctorate may substitute for six years of experience.
